It is thus necessary to evaluate the existing ones. Below are the things to look at when finding student rentals Oxford Ohio.

Take time to search. After managing to secure a position in a university in a new location, take the task of looking for accommodation. Since you are not conversant with the environment, it is important to do research. Various options are available such as the internet or asking around from people. The internet can be a more reliable source, and thus consider using it.

Factor in the budget. The budget is an important factor to note since the houses are available at different rates. It is an expense to incur every month for as long as you are still a student, and thus the need to plan for it. Among the major causes of the variation in the prices is the size of the rooms. Ask from the owners or other tenants already residing there and determine the place you can afford.

Check the size of the rooms. Space is necessary to give allowance so that the place does not become stuffy. Besides, it is necessary to have a place to rest as well as somewhere for your private studies at home. While choosing the size, these are among the things to take into account, although most importantly is the number of household equipment you have. Look for one that accommodates all.

Look at the state of the house. Some people are careless and leave the place in poor states. Also, other landlords are no keen on maintaining their property in proper conditions. It is thus possible to find broken windows or even doors among other faults. Ensure to do a complete survey on the condition of the room and other amenities and confirm they are in a suitable state.

Ask if the owner has accreditation. There exist some associations with which the landlords register. Letting out from one who is a member is advisable since there is proof that the person has no hidden ill intentions such as defrauding people. Choose a recognized owner and also check if they have an agreement with the institution or the student body.

Ask about insurance. In some cases, the landlords are keen about the safety of their property. Consequently, they take up an insurance cover to cater for the building and all other property the tenants use. Getting such a place is beneficial, although this is a rare case to find. Consider taking a personal insurance cover if your landlord does not provide, or move to another place.
